- 1、本文档共15页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
《数据库技术》实验报告
2013—2014学年第一学期
专业:
班级:
学号:
姓名:
授课教师:陈延寿 张弓
实验学时: 10
经管院信管系
2013年9月
目 录
实验一 数据库的查询与统计 1
实验二 简单程序设计 3
实验三 菜单设计 4
实验四 表单控件设计 7
实验五 报表设计 8
实验一 数据库的查询与统计
实验目的:熟悉VFP环境、熟悉VFP常用命令即函数,掌握VFP中的排序、索引、顺序查询和索引查询。
实验内容:
1.先建立如下所示的设备表sb.dbf。
字段结构:
编号C(5),名称C(6),启用日期D,价格N(9,2),部门C(2),主要设备L,备注M,商标G
操作要求:
建立sb.dbf的结构后,立即输入前5个记录的数据,其中头两个记录的商标字段,由读者在Windows环境下选两个图标分别输入。数据输入后存盘退出。
打开sb.dbf,分别查看其结构与记录,包括备注字段与商标字段的数据。
追加最后两个记录,结束后分别以浏览格式和编辑格式查看数据。
2.打开sb.dbf,试为下列要求分别写出命令序列,在命令窗口运行。
(1)显示第5个记录。
(2)显示第3个记录开始的5个记录。
(3)显示第3个记录到第5个记录。
(4)显示价格少于10000的设备的名称,价格,部门。
(5)显示部门首字母为1或第2个字母为3的设备的所有信息。
答案:
(1) DISPLAY RECORD 5
(2) GO 3
DISPLAY NEXT 5
(3) GO 3
DISPLAY NEXT 3
(4) DISPLAY FOR 价格10000 FIELDS 名称,价格,部门
(5) DISPLAY FOR SUBSTR(部门,1,1)= “1” OR SUBSTR(部门,2,1)= “3”
3. 试对SB.DBF分别排序,在命令窗口中实现下面的排序:
将价格超过10000元的设备按部门升序排序,并要求新文件只包含编号、名称、价格、部门四个字段。
将主要设备按名称降序排序,当名称相同时则按启用日期降序排序。
用表设计器来为SB.DBF建立一个结构复合索引文件,其中包括3个索引:
记录以价格降序排列,索引标识为普通索引型。
记录以部门升序排列,部门相同时则按价格升序排列,索引标识为普通索引型。
记录以部门升序排列,部门相同时则按价格降序排列,索引标识为候选索引型。
5.分别用顺序查询和索引查询两种方法查询1992年启用的非主要设备。
实验总结:(实验中遇到的问题及解决办法、心得、体会等等...)
实验二 简单程序设计
实验目的:学习简单的程序设计,掌握顺序结构、分支结构和循环结构。
实验内容:
第1题:若要修改某设备的价格和部门,试编程序。
设备表下载: 将 sb.dbf 和 sb.fpt 下载到本地
第2题:已知成绩.DBF含有学号、平时、考试、等级等字段,前三个字段已存有某班学生的数据,平时成绩、考试成绩均填入了百分制数。请以平时成绩20%、考试成绩80%的比例确定等级并填入等级字段。等级评定办法是:90分以上为优,75~89为良,60~74为及格,60分以下不及格。要求用条件、步长、扫描3种循环语句分别编出程序。
成绩表下载:将chengji.dbf下载到本地VFP默认目录,然后将其重命名为成绩.dbf
实验总结:(实验中遇到的问题及解决办法、心得、体会等等...)
实验三 菜单设计
实验目的:熟悉使用VFP的菜单设计器来设计菜单。
实验内容:
[例5-2] 利用菜单设计器建立如下图所示的下拉式菜单,并要求:
(1)“打印”菜单包括“设备表”和“设备价格表”两个菜单项。
(2)“数据维护”菜单的“浏览记录”菜单项能用来打开一个设备浏览窗口。
操作步骤如下:
打开“菜单设计器”窗口:向命令窗口输入命令modify menu sb。
菜单栏页的设置:在“菜单设计器”窗口填入如下图所示的4个菜单项。图中用注释“do cx”来表示查询程序尚未编制。
为“数据维护”菜单建立选项:单击数据维护行的某处—选定“创建”按纽使“菜单设计器”窗口切换到子菜单页(菜单级组合框中将显示“数据维护” )—建立两个菜单项如图:
为“浏览记录”菜单项定义快捷键:选定“浏览记录”菜单行“选项”列的按纽—在“提示选项”对话框中单击键标签文本框,然后按CTRL+X组合键,字串CTRL+X就自动填入文本框中—单击“确定”按纽返回“菜单设计器”窗口—选定菜单级组合框中的菜单栏选项返回菜单栏页。
为“打
文档评论(0)